I am choosing to ride in the Towpath Community Go Pink bike ride to honor the memory of my mother Alice Verstreate who passed away from breast cancer in 1978. When I was a Freshman in college I received the news that my Mom had stage 4 breast cancer and was given just 6 months to live. Thankfully, she beat that prediction and lived to see me graduate but those were tough years filled with pain and suffering. She died at just 50 years old, in the prime of her life.
I will ride my bike each and every time I can to help raise funds to help those affected by cancer. It is the least I can do.

Towpath Bike Shop and the Towpath Community Foundation will host the annual Go Pink! ride and run on Sunday, October 13, 2019 at Mendon Ponds Park in Rochester. The event includes 10/25/50 mile rides and 5K trail run and post-race celebration. Proceeds support the Breast Cancer Research Initiative at the Wilmot Cancer Institute.
